Up for sale today with much sadness is my 1987 corvette. I have driven and owned my fair share of cars and for the money I don't think that you can find a car that is even close to as fun to drive as the C4 corvette but if you are looking at this listing chances are you already know this. I spent 2 years trying to find a car that had most of its major components working as well as a car that was high optioned for the time this car has the rare Delco Bose stereo, digital climate control electric seats and windows mirrors and the clear Targa roof and most importantly and Atuo transmission but why an auto in a sports car, these cars from 1984 to 1989 had a 4 + 3 trans that always had some sort of problem while the Autos were problem free. This car is in nice shape for a 25+ year old car but its shows its age in places. The car will also need a good motor tune up and it does have a lifter tic but it still runs and drives fine. Exterior: The paint is in ok shape with some problems the front bumper has been painted but is paint is dull but it still looks good unless you are on top of it. The rear quarter and the rear bumper has nicks and dings and could use paint otherwise the paint is in good shape for a 25 + year old car.

Interior: When I purchased the car it had seats that were in poor shape and carpet that had seen too much sun so I had to replace them. I found seats that were recovered re padded and had rebuilt motors. The carpet was taken from the same donor car and while it is not new it is in better shape then the old carpet. The interior is taken care of and I will supply an extra set of door panels as well I did not do them because the door panels are still in good shape but I wanted a set anyway. 

Driveline: The motor starts every time with no issue with only 82000 miles. The car when I got it had a old set of headers that had to go along with holes in the front and year y pipes with I have replaced the mufflers were done by last owner. The auto trans shifts like new with no problems even in the cold. BUT the car will need a good tune up and THE CAR HAS A LIFTER TIC in the rear passenger side cylinder. Otherwise Id daily drive if I could.

Electronics: As most of you know the dash boards in these cars almost never work until they are rebuilt which this one has been and works like a charm has not let me down yet. The radio works most of the time but does go in and out( id have it redone). The digi climate control works well and the AC and heat work well. Lights go up and down with no problems and the turn signals work ( lever needs to be tightened).

Problems: While this car is in good shape it still needs some paint work. Id suggest plugs and wires and tighten up the header bolts and have the lifter tic looked into I was told by my local mechanic that it could be as simple as a lose bolt or a set of lifters. These are the Items I know need attention but the car is so close to being done it won't take much to bring it there.

GM isn't liable for punitive damages in ignition switch cases

Wed, Nov 20 2019

NEW YORK — A federal appeals court said General Motors is not liable for punitive damages over accidents that occurred after its 2009 bankruptcy and involved vehicles it produced earlier, including vehicles with faulty ignition switches. The 2nd U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als in Manhattan said on Tuesday that the automaker did not agree to contractually assume liability for punitive damages as part of its federally-backed Chapter 11 reorganization. GM filed for bankruptcy in June 2009, and its best assets were transferred to a new Detroit-based company with the same name. The other assets and many liabilities stayed with "Old GM," which is also known as Motors Liquidation Co. Tuesday's 3-0 decision may help GM reduce its ultimate exposure in nationwide litigation over defective ignition switches in several Chevrolet, Pontiac and Saturn models. It is also a defeat for drivers involved in post-bankruptcy accidents, including those who collided with older GM vehicles driven by others, as well as their law firms. The ignition switch defect could cause engine stalls and keep airbags from deploying, and has been linked to 124 deaths. A lawyer for the drivers and their law firms did not immediately respond to requests for comment. GM had no comment. Circuit Judge Dennis Jacobs said GM's agreement to acquire assets "free and clear" of most liabilities excused it from punitive damages claims for Old GM's conduct. He also noted that the judge who oversaw the bankruptcy concluded that the new company could not be liable for claims that the "deeply insolvent" Old GM would never have paid. The decision upheld a May 2018 ruling by U.S. District Judge Jesse Furman in Manhattan, who oversees the ignition switch litigation. Drivers have sought a variety of damages in that litigation, including for declining resale values. GM has recalled more than 2.6 million vehicles since 2014 over ignition switch problems. It has also paid more than $2.6 billion in related penalties and settlements, including $900 million to settle a U.S. Department of Justice criminal case. GMC Envoy could be returning as GM files for 'Envoy' trademark

Thu, Dec 27 2018

The GMC Envoy could be on its way back, if a recent GM trademark filing is any indication of the future. To be exact, GM's trademark filing is for the name "Envoy," and is applicable to "motor vehicles, namely, sport utility vehicles, engines therefor and structural parts thereof." A victim of the recession and high gas prices, the original Envoy – related to the Blazer, and more recently the TrailBlazer and similar GM SUVs – was discontinued after the 2009 model year. In today's SUV-happy market of low gas prices, unearthing the somewhat familiar Envoy name makes a certain amount of sense. As soon as gas prices start trending in the other direction, we'll all be saying the opposite, though. What this SUV will take shape as is the big question now. With the Chevrolet Blazer well and truly on its way, there's every reason for a GMC version of Chevy's stylish new crossover sporting the Envoy name. Another, less likely, possibility is a Traverse-sized vehicle to slot between the shorter Acadia (10 inches shorter than the Chevy Traverse) and the body-on-frame Yukon. GM could come out of left field and make the Envoy a Buick too. It fits the bill with the "En" beginning, and Buick undoubtedly has crossovers in the works. We think that's even more unlikely, but it's important to remember that we're still in the speculation phase. Soon we'll drive Chevy's new Blazer, and perhaps have more news then.
